Motorola unveils MOTOKRZR handset

Published on 07/24/2006

The MOTORAZR is rendered obsolete with the introduction of the new Motorola MOTOKRZR cellphone. This handset boasts a 2 megapixel camera, a 262k color screen, stereo Bluetooth audio, new messaging applications, integrated music playback capability, and an updated phone directory. It is available in 2 versions - CDMA and GSM, where the former edges out the latter with the addition of touch-sensitive music controls as well as support for advanced EVDO data services where the situation warrants it. • Ultra-slim form factor• Hi-quality imaging via 2MP digital camera with 8x digital zoom, and image editing• Premium video capabilities: video capture and playback MPEG4 (15 fps CIF); audio/video streaming (3GPP); video progressive download; record up to 25 minutes of video on embedded memory• Integrated Stereo Bluetooth wireless technology connectivity for hands-free convenience• Enhanced phonebook with new contact fields: URL, IM, Postal Address, Birthday, and other information• MicroSD slot for optional upgradeable memory• EDGE for high speed data access (class 12)• Rich, pre-loaded J2ME games, screen savers• Downloadable themes, ringer tones, images, animations• Midi, MP3, AAC, AAC+ enhanced music player for listening to your favorite music on-the-go• PIM functionality with Picture Caller ID• Voice memo, enhanced predictive text and enhanced voice recognition for easy, hands-free connectivity• MotoSync – sync your contacts and calendar at the touch of a button• Push-To-View for sharing of images real time• Screen 3 technology for zero-click access to your favorite news, sports, and other premium content
